2007 PEV Was a Blessing in Disguise for Police Service - Former NPS Boss

The former police boss argued that the tragic events became an unintended driver for the professionalisation of law enforcement in Kenya...
✨ Key Highlights
Former police spokesperson Charles Owino has controversially claimed that the tragic 2007/08 post-election violence (PEV), which resulted in over 1,000 deaths, was a "blessing in disguise" for police reforms in Kenya.
- The PEV provided the urgent impetus for reforms, despite a 2004 strategic plan recommending changes that had remained unimplemented.
- Owino, now Director General of the National Council on Correctional Services, highlighted that the crisis led to the establishment of the Waki and Kriegler commissions.
- The reforms ultimately led to the creation of the National Police Service (NPS), the Office of the Inspector General, and the Independent Policing Oversight Authority (IPOA) under the 2010 Constitution.
